Understanding the Legal Terrain of THC in Australia

Australia has a complex and evolving legal system when it comes to THC, the psychoactive component of cannabis. While medicinal cannabis is becoming increasingly accessible with certain authorizations, recreational use remains largely banned. People seeking to obtain THC for recreational purposes must carefully understand the specific regulations in place. It's essential to consult legal counselors to fully understand the implications and potential consequences of THC use in Australia.

Moreover, it's crucial to be aware that owning even small amounts of THC can result in severe penalties. Consequently, staying informed about the latest developments in THC legislation is crucial for anyone residing in Australia.

Understanding the Effects and Benefits of THC

Tetrahydrocannabinol, commonly known as THC, is an primary psychoactive compound found in cannabis. It affects with your body's endocannabinoid system, that plays a role in regulating a variety of functions such as mood, appetite, and sleep. THC can produce {a range ofeffects, from euphoria and relaxation to increased attention and altered perception. While THC can have potential therapeutic benefits for conditions like chronic pain and stress, it's essential to be aware of its potential risks, including cognitive difficulties. Understanding the effects and benefits of THC is crucial for making informed decisions about it's.

Obtaining THC in Australia

Navigating the legal landscape surrounding cannabis goods in Australia can be a bit of a puzzle. While recreational use remains against the law, certain medicinal cannabis products are accessible with a valid prescription from a doctor. Get your hands on these legal THC-containing products, you'll need to consult with a registered medical professional who can assess if cannabis is an appropriate treatment option for your situation.

  • Trusted online dispensaries, licensed under Australian law, are a common avenue for purchasing medicinal cannabis products.
  • Always ensure the dispensary you choose is fully authorized.

Remember, strict regulations govern the production, distribution, and consumption of THC in Australia. It's crucial to adhere to these rules to stay out of trouble.
